Goin’ Back

Goin’ Back contains songs Cahir heard in his formative years when he was growing up in his father’s pub or listening to his uncle Matt before he started singing rock and blues.

It is a retrospective look at his childhood influences in Ireland before he came to America and is an insight into the man and his music.

As with all his recordings, the album includes some of his own compositions which are always very popular – Kirkinriola and Wanderin’

Willie.

Cahir O’Doherty Live

Cahir O Doherty Live was recorded over several nights in Brennan’s Irish Pub in Holiday Fl and produced by Steve Stange.

You can hear for yourself how it really captures the typical

atmosphere and enjoyment of Cahir’s gigs and the unique rapport he

creates with his audiences. There is one of his own songs, Cosy Corner,

included in the mix.

The owner of the pub Mike Brennan from County Mayo has unfortunately since passed away, but his wife Margaret and three daughters have carried on the tradition and Cahir still plays there to loyal fans and an increasing number of discerning young people seeking good Irish music.

19 Great Irish Songs

19 Great Irish Songs is acompilation of Cahir’s first two very successful cassettes which were simply known as Volume 1 and Volume 2.

These early recordings launched his career in America as an accomplished Irish folk singer. Original songs by Cahir on this CD are The Curse of Immigration and Rosaleen.

Vol 1 was recorded in Ireland featuring members of The Chieftains and The Dubliners.

It was produced by Eamon Campbell, a well known member of The Dubliners.

Vol 2 was produced by Cahir and a good friend from his rock and roll days, Liam Reilly from Bagatelle.

About The Artist

Cahir O'Doherty is a professional musician best known for his strong resonant voice and lilting guitar producing incomparable Irish and American folk music which people enormously enjoy. Ballads, love songs, humour and traditional sing-a-longs are all within his cheery compass and a good time is guaranteed in the company of this very entertaining singer.

Born in Ireland, Cahir started out as a rock and blues singer and was an immediate success with appearances in Jesus Christ Superstar [Pontius Pilate] and Joseph and his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at [The Pharaoh].

Hit records saw him appearing with some of the top names in the music business such as The Rolling Stones, Everly Brothers, Fleetwood Mac, Tom Jones, Ben E King and Van Morrison.

Cahir is now an American citizen and among the great songs of Ireland, including his own original compositions, do not be surprised to hear some Bob Dylan and John Prine with a bit of good old rock 'n roll thrown in for fine measure.
